Abstract
Polycrystalline garnet ferrites of general compsn. Y3-3xGd3xFe5-5y-2uAl5yCouSiuO12 (where O x =0.6; O = y =0.24; 0.09 = u =0.25) and which exhibit negligeably low magnetic losses over frequency ranges at U.H.F. whilst maintaining relative permeability >1. In partic. the low loss regions for partic. cpds. are:- Y3Fe4.8Coo.1Sio.1O12 is approx 1200 MHz; Y3Fe4.5Coo.25 Sio.25 O12 1100-1500MHz; Y1.5Gd1.5Fe4.8Coo.1SiOo.1 O12 1000-2000MHz; Y1.5Gd1.5Fe4.7Coo.15Sio.15O12 0.150 MHz and 1000-3000 MHz; Y2.7Gdo.3Fe3.8Al Coo.1Sio.O12 300-850 MHz.
